If you upgrade ScreenOS Version from lower 6.3 to 6.3.x you must deactivate DHCP-Server. When the DHCP-Server is activated at booting the SSG boot process loops.
If you can't deactivate the DHCP Server before the upgrade then do following.
Copy the command line STRG-C:
unset interface bgroup dhcp server service
After the SSG reboots you have some seconds to login and to paste the command with STRG-V. After that the SSG will not reboot. Save the configuration with save. Now you can add a new DHCP configuration.
We have the problem with upgrades to 6.3.0r21.0 from lower versions. If you deactivate the DHCP Server before the upgrade everything is fine.
